The 1960's Bossa Nova movement in jazz became the new cross-over music with numerous popular music stars recording the catchy rhythms and quiet demeanor of this hybrid Brazilian music. Antonio Carlos Jobim was literally the high priest of the music form and recorded quite a few albums especially this one which was called “A Certain Mr. Jobim,” recorded in 1967 and arranged and conducted by Claus Ogerman. “Desafinado” or “Off-Key” was written by Jobim as an answer to critics who wrote that he had no talent and certainly no sense of pitch!
